SPARK-1973. Add randomSplit to JavaRDD (with tests, and tidy Java tests)
Browse files Browse the repository at this point in the history
I'd like to use randomSplit through the Java API, and would like to add a convenience wrapper for this method to JavaRDD. This is fairly trivial. (In fact, is the intent that JavaRDD not wrap every RDD method? and that sometimes users should just use JavaRDD.wrapRDD()?)

Along the way, I added tests for it, and also touched up the Java API test style and behavior. This is maybe the more useful part of this small change.

Expand Up @@ -108,6 +108,28 @@ class JavaRDD[T](val rdd: RDD[T])(implicit val classTag: ClassTag[T])
def sample(withReplacement: Boolean, fraction: Double, seed: Long): JavaRDD[T] =
wrapRDD(rdd.sample(withReplacement, fraction, seed))


/**
* Randomly splits this RDD with the provided weights.
*
* @param weights weights for splits, will be normalized if they don't sum to 1
*
* @return split RDDs in an array
*/
def randomSplit(weights: Array[Double]): Array[JavaRDD[T]] =
randomSplit(weights, Utils.random.nextLong)

/**
* Randomly splits this RDD with the provided weights.
*
* @param weights weights for splits, will be normalized if they don't sum to 1
* @param seed random seed
*
* @return split RDDs in an array
*/
def randomSplit(weights: Array[Double], seed: Long): Array[JavaRDD[T]] =
rdd.randomSplit(weights, seed).map(wrapRDD)
